A dad tried to strangle his ex-girlfriend hours after being granted bail in a terrifying campaign of domestic abuse.
Ben Polland first assaulted his former partner, who the Sunday Mail have chosen not to name, in February after turning up at the new mum’s Ayrshire home and threatening to kill her.
In March, Polland, the step-son of William Kelly. who killed his own mum Cathy by setting her on fire, appeared at Kilmarnock Sheriff Court and admitted breaching an order not to contact his ex.
However, hours after being granted bail he turned up at the 22-year-old’s home again and assaulted her.
He repeatedly punched the mum, who had given birth only weeks before, on the head and body before putting his hands around her neck and restricting her breathing.
Dad-of-one Polland, 19, from Galston, Ayrshire, appeared at Kilmarnock Sheriff Court in May where he admitted assaulting his ex and threatening to kill her in February.
He was handed a Community Payback Order, ordered to undertake alcohol treatment and told to participate in the Caledonian Programme aimed at tackling domestic abuse earlier this month.
He was also placed on the Restriction of Liberty Order for six months.
Last night, a source close to the family, who did not want to be identified, hit out at Polland’s sentence.
He said: “A slap on the wrists for treating someone that way is no deterrent at all. Instead, Polland remains emboldened, he gets away with it every time.
“How many chances do domestic abusers need to be given?
“Ben grew up with Kelly as a stepdad and knowing the violence Kelly inflicted on his mum Cathy, it’s worrying that such a young offender is allowed to think violence against women is okay.”
Polland is due to be sentenced in September.

Todd Spangler NY Digital Editor The Supreme Court ruled against a group of conservatives who sued the Biden administration — alleging the White House violated the First Amendment by pressuring Facebook and other tech platforms to remove “disinformation” — saying they failed to show they were harmed by the administration’s efforts. In the 6-3 ruling issued Wednesday, the Supreme Court said the individual and state plaintiffs in the case did not have standing to seek a preliminary injunction against federal executive-branch officials and agencies over their official communications with social-media companies about the spread of misinformation online.
